In Short: A study from the College of Agriculture, Health and Natural Resources found using farm-specific data improves the accuracy of measuring milk's environmental impact.

A new study from the College of Agriculture, Health and Natural Resources (CAHNR) has determined a more accurate measure of the carbon footprint of milk produced in Bangladesh.

According to Anna Zarra Aldrich, a researcher at CAHNR, this study demonstrated that using farm-specific data helps more accurately measure the environmental impact of creating and delivering milk.

Every product or service has a “carbon footprint,” a measure of the environmental impact of creating or delivering it.
